Coaching Structure

Each age group has a head coach to direct activities and drills, with assistants spread around to maintain supervision and support. In their first season of play, players will receive a disc and jersey. In our 3-5 age group, guardians and their children participate together. For ages 12 and up, athletes will compete among their gender when possible. For ages 6 and up, guardians are welcome to apply as coaches or assistants by emailing youth@wods.ca.


Parents are invited to meet the coaches on the first night. Signed waivers must be brought to the coaches before athletes step onto the field. Age Groups

  • 3 to 5 - Fundamental Physical Skill
  • 6 to 8 - Fundamentals of Sport and Ultimate
  • 9 to 11 - Learning to play Ultimate
  • 12 to 15 - Open & Women - Playing Ultimate and Learning New Skills

Parental Supervision Required

  • 3 to 5 - One parent present on sideline minimum. We recommend that guardians participate with the player for whom they are responsible
  • 6 to 8 - Guardian must be in the park
  • 9 to 11 - Guardian must be in the park
  • 12 to 15 - Guardian must drop player off and be ready to pick them up an hour after session begins

Length of Play Time:

  • 3 to 5 - 45 minutes max, some nights will end earlier depending on children
  • 6 to 8 - 1 hour
  • 9 to 11 - 1.5 hours
  • 12 to 15 - 1.5 hours

Weather Policy

  • 3 to 5 - Cancelled for rain
  • 6 to 8 - Cancelled for rain
  • 9 to 11 - Play at coaches' discretion unless there is lightning
  • 12 to 15 - Play at coaches' discretion unless there is lightning
